Understanding Advanced Waste Equipment



Advanced waste equipment includes a variety of cutting-edge modern technologies developed to boost waste monitoring processes effectively. This equipment includes automated arranging systems, compactors, shredders, and advanced recycling machinery, all focused on improving effectiveness and lessening environmental influence. The key objective of sophisticated waste equipment is to streamline the collection, handling, and disposal of waste materials, therefore decreasing labor costs and increasing functional effectiveness.


One noteworthy technology is making use of clever waste containers equipped with sensing units that check waste degrees and optimize collection paths. This not only reduces unneeded pickups yet additionally reduces gas consumption and greenhouse gas emissions. Furthermore, progressed shredders and compactors promote the reduction of waste volume, which is essential for making best use of garbage dump space and boosting recycling efforts.


Additionally, the combination of artificial knowledge and device learning in waste monitoring systems permits enhanced information analytics, leading to informed decision-making and enhanced resource allowance. By employing these advanced technologies, organizations and organizations can accomplish significant improvements in waste monitoring procedures, eventually leading to far better sustainability outcomes and conformity with governing standards.


Cost Evaluation of Financial Investment





Reviewing the price evaluation of financial investment in sophisticated waste devices is important for organizations seeking to improve their waste management techniques. A detailed cost evaluation includes evaluating both the initial capital investment and recurring operational expenditures connected with obtaining and maintaining such devices. This includes not only the acquisition rate yet also installation prices, training for workers, and possible downtime throughout the change period.




Organizations have to also consider the various types of advanced waste devices offered, such as compactors, shredders, and recycling systems, each with unique rates frameworks. Furthermore, the monetary implications of equipment effectiveness need to be assessed, as a lot more effective systems may cause decreased waste disposal charges and reduced source consumption.


Additionally, prospective funding resources and incentives, such as government gives or tax credit histories, can substantially impact the overall price analysis. By conducting an extensive evaluation of these elements, services can make informed decisions that straighten with their sustainability goals while guaranteeing a sound monetary investment (baler rental). Long-Term Financial Savings Prospective



Buying advanced waste equipment not just involves an upfront financial dedication yet additionally opens up the door to significant lasting cost savings possibility. Organizations and companies that carry out such technology can expect to see a reduction in functional expenses in time. Advanced waste devices frequently enhances waste management processes, leading to lowered labor expenses and improved performance.


By automating waste sorting and processing, organizations decrease the need for hands-on labor, permitting staff to concentrate on more value-added activities. Moreover, enhanced waste administration systems can lessen the volume of waste that winds up in garbage dumps, which consequently reduces disposal charges and possible regulative penalties connected with waste mismanagement.


In addition to route cost savings, organizations can additionally experience enhanced revenue chances. As an example, recycling programs can create earnings from the sale of recovered products. Furthermore, a dedication to advanced waste management can improve a firm's reputation, bring in environmentally conscious consumers and customers, which might bring about increased market share.


Environmental Effect Assessment



Just how do innovative waste administration systems add to environmental sustainability? The implementation of these systems permits for the effective separation of recyclable products, which can substantially reduce the quantity of waste routed to landfills, therefore lowering methane exhausts internet and other damaging contaminants linked with waste decay.


Additionally, progressed waste management services are developed to decrease energy consumption and boost functional effectiveness. For circumstances, energy-efficient equipment not only reduces general energy usage but also decreases greenhouse gas emissions, aligning with international sustainability objectives. The adoption of these systems can promote a culture of environmental responsibility within companies, urging staff members to engage in sustainable practices.




Conducting a comprehensive environmental influence assessment of these systems reveals their possible advantages, including enhanced air and water top quality, biodiversity preservation, and improved community health.
